Due to the lack of audiologists in our area, I relied upon family to recommend someone. THIS is the place. We needed this all to be done remotely, which Ms. Lanson, Lindsay, assured us was almost as good as coming into the office. We emailed Lindsay a hearing test performed at a big-name brand that was offering a free hearing test. Lindsay used those results to give us a number of choices based upon my husbands daily situation. Work in an office? Dine out often? Have regular large family gatherings? Everything was taken into consideration. Once the choice was made, Lindsay ordered the hearing aides, had them sent to her office to program them and then sent them directly to us, along with different choices of in-ear buds and wire-lengths to ensure the perfect fit. Lindsay then visited with my husband in an hour-long session, first by telephone and then on line, via the app that comes with the your purchase, fine tuning the hearing aides, explaining all of the features and ensuring he understood how to best use those features, such as the Blue Tooth connection with your phone.My husband could not be happier. First, they are much smaller than ones were were shown at that other place. You have your choice of colors so that little tiny ear piece blends in with your hair color. The wires that go into the ear with the earbud attached are clear. I really couldnt see the hearing aide at all, until my husband said he was wearing them and showed them to me. I had to look closely to see them!They are fully rechargeable, so no batteries to buy. That means there is no battery door to break and no fiddling with those itty bitty batteries, which can be difficult when someone has arthritis or is visually-challenged.And his hearing...he should have done this ages ago! The TV volume has gone from 30 to 8, I dont have to repeat myself constantly and he doesnt have to guess, often wrongly, at what I actually said. I know that he doesnt feel quite so isolated because he cant hear everything that is being said.All in all, we couldnt be happier with the results! We both highly recommend ENT of Georgia South-Fayetteville. I imagine your in-house visit will be just as good, if not better, as our remote experience. Thank you Lindsay!
